How can I apply for a vehicle circulation permit in Chile?

The circulation permit for a vehicle is processed at the Municipality corresponding to your address. You must present the vehicle documents, mandatory insurance and pay municipal taxes and fees.

Can judicial records in Venezuela be used in international adoption processes?

Yes, judicial records in Venezuela can be used in international adoption processes. The authorities in charge of adoption in the destination country may require the judicial records of the adopters to evaluate their suitability and guarantee the well-being of the minor. These background information can be considered as part of the legal and protection requirements of the international adoption process.

What happens if a person has a judicial record in a foreign country and wants to live in Peru?

The presence of a judicial record in a foreign country may affect a person's ability to obtain a visa or residence permit in Peru. Immigration authorities may consider this background when making a decision.
